During the media scrum for the upcoming ROH Final Battle pay-per-view this weekend, Tony Khan revealed some of the details behind William Regal’s departure from AEW and return to WWE. Khan said that Regal approached Megha Parekh, who is part of AEW’s legal team, with a request for the promotion not to renew his deal, as he wanted to return to WWE. Not only is his son working in WWE, but he also wanted to coach alongside some of his old friends now that Triple H has gained control of the company. Furthermore, Khan says that Regal’s release dictates he can go back to WWE and coach but not be an on-air personality in 2023. During this week’s AEW Dynamite, a fan jumped the barricade and approached the ring during a Chris Jericho and Maxwell Jacob Friedman segment. Security got rid of the fan and Jericho himself even got in a shot on him. Later, the fan sent out a tweet saying that he was doing this due to Jim Cornette’s comments over the AEW roster being pretend wrestlers. Cornette and Jericho responded to the fan’s tweet and it did not go well.
